기출문제/정보처리기사

2018년 2회 정보처리기사 기출문제 57번

엉클지니 2025. 5. 31. 14:07

57. 유닉스의 i-node 에 포함되는 정보가 아닌 것은?

    디스크 상의 물리적 주소

    파일 소유자의 사용자 식별

    파일이 처음 사용된 시간

    파일에 대한 링크 수

 

300x250

 

 


이 문제는 유닉스(UNIX)의 파일 시스템 구조, 특히 **i-node(inode)**에 저장되는 정보를 정확히 알고 있는지를 묻고 있습니다.


✅ 정답: ❸ 파일이 처음 사용된 시간


🔍 i-node(inode)란?

  • 유닉스 파일 시스템에서 각 파일을 설명하는 자료 구조
  • 파일의 메타데이터(속성 정보)를 저장
  • 실제 파일 이름은 디렉토리 항목에 있고, i-node는 **파일 자체의 정보(소유자, 권한, 크기 등)**를 담음

✅ i-node에 포함되는 정보

포함 여부 정보 항목 설명

✅ 포함됨 디스크 상의 물리적 주소 파일의 실제 데이터가 저장된 블록 위치 정보
✅ 포함됨 파일 소유자의 사용자 식별자 (UID) 파일 소유자 식별
❌ 포함되지 않음 파일이 처음 사용된 시간 (accessed) 최초 접근 시간은 저장되지 않음
✅ 포함됨 파일에 대한 링크 수 하드 링크 수 (같은 i-node를 참조하는 디렉토리 항목 수)

✅ 유닉스에서는 보통 3가지 시간 정보를 저장합니다:

  • ctime (Change time): i-node 자체가 변경된 시간
  • mtime (Modified time): 파일 내용이 수정된 시간
  • atime (Access time): 파일에 마지막으로 접근한 시간
    "처음 사용된 시간"은 저장하지 않습니다!

🔧 보기별 분석

번호 보기 내용 포함 여부 해설

① 디스크 상의 물리적 주소 ✅ 포함 i-node의 핵심 기능  
② 파일 소유자의 사용자 식별 ✅ 포함 UID 정보 포함  
❸ 파일이 처음 사용된 시간 불포함 처음 사용된 시간은 i-node에 저장 안 됨  
④ 파일에 대한 링크 수 ✅ 포함 하드 링크 수 저장됨  

✅ 최종 정답: ❸ 파일이 처음 사용된 시간